Russian President Vladimir Putin is welcomed by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i upon arrival at Beijing Capital International Airport in Beijing on May 19, 2026. Vladimir Smirnov/Pool/AFP via Getty ImagesRussian President Vladimir Putin arrived in Beijing on May 19, only four days after U.S. President Donald Trump left China.An insider within the Chinese regime told The Epoch Times that one of the key objectives of Putin’s visit to Beijing is to obtain firsthand “information” regarding the summit with Trump and Chinese leader Xi Jinping, specifically concerning the Russia–Ukraine war and the situation in the Middle East.
